DSS Microcomputer: A Digital Renaissance from the Archives of Yesteryear
Ah, the BBC Microcomputer! While we never had the pleasure of housing the actual machines in our Custer workshop, fate delivered unto us something perhaps more precious—the original brass legend inserts, discovered during what I call an "archaeological dig" through our vast archives. Like finding hieroglyphs that unlock an ancient language, these brass treasures emerged from a forgotten filing cabinet, nestled between color swatches from the Great Beige Era and several prototype molds from when DSA was merely a twinkle in our designer's eye. This DSS Microcomputer set marries these recovered artifacts with our modern manufacturing artistry, allowing us to recreate that iconic British computing aesthetic with obsessive precision.
We've color-matched the distinctive red, olive and black scheme through seventeen iterations (testing under three different lighting conditions, as is tradition), ensuring that typing on these caps will transport you back to the days when BASIC was the lingua franca of computing enthusiasts. Each doubleshot legend is created through a dance of machines and human hands—our vintage brass inserts guided by artisans who remember when keycaps arrived in manila envelopes and group buys were conducted via mail order forms. The result is a set that honors computing heritage while delivering the unique DSS profile experience: that Goldilocks zone between SA's towering presence and DSA's low-profile humility.

For those unfamiliar, the DSS sits in that beautiful location not as tall as the SA, but has more sculpting than the DSA.
